Athlete hand drying system
First Claim
1. A system to dry the hands of individuals, the system comprising:
- a pedestal;
an air pedal hinged to the pedestal;
a powder pedal hinged to the pedestal;
a chamber having a shroud connected below and to a dome to define a chamber interior, where the shroud is an annulus shaped ring that includes a left hand hole, a right hand hole, and a partition, where the left hand hole and the right hand hole each are openings in the shroud through which a person'"'"'s hands may be inserted and where the partition is position vertically to divide the chamber interior into a first divided area and a second divided area that correspond to the left hand hole and the right hand hole, respectively, and into an overhead area beneath the dome that connects the first divided area and the second divided area;
a left tube positioned in the first divided area;
a right tube positioned in the second divided area;
a tower positioned between the pedestal and the chamber;
an air compressor connected to the air pedal, the powder pedal, a first air hose, and a second air hose, where the first air hose is connected to the left tube and the right tube and the second air hose is connected to a powder container, where the powder container is configured to store powder to be delivered through the left tube and the right tube into chamber interior, and where the air pedal and the powder pedal are foot controlled and configured to operate an on/off state of the air compressor; and
an air regulator connected between the powder container and the left tube and the right tube.

Abstract
Disclosed is a system to dry the hands of individuals. The system may include a pedestal, an air pedal and powder pedal hinged to the pedestal, a chamber having a dome connected to a shroud to define a chamber interior. The chamber interior may be divided into a first divided area, a second divided, and an overhead area that connects the first divided area to the second divided area. Each dived area may include a perforated tube to deliver pressurized air and powder into the chamber interior. An air compressor may be connected directly to the perforated tubes and connected to a powder chamber. In addition to pressurized air being delivered to the chamber interior, powder optionally may be delivered to the chamber interior.
